A cable design engineer is responsible for designing and developing various types of cables used in industries, telecommunications, and power systems. They work closely with clients, project managers, and other engineers to understand the requirements and specifications of a cable system. The engineer then designs and creates detailed plans, ensuring the cables are safe, efficient, and meet industry standards. They consider factors such as material selection, insulation, conductor size, shielding, and environmental conditions.
The engineer also conducts tests and simulations to validate the design and troubleshoot any issues that arise during the manufacturing or installation process. Additionally, they may provide technical support, review documentation, and collaborate with suppliers to ensure quality control.

Cable Design Engineer salary in Nigeria
Average Yearly Salary of Cable Design Engineer in Nigeria is approximately 6,061,964 NGN (7,256 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
